How to Brew: Pomegranate Detox Kombucha (F1 Method)

1. The Ingredients

  • Tea Base: 2 1/2 quarts of filtered water + 4–6 bags of organic black or green tea. You can also use whole leaf tea as well ( 1 cup of water per 1 tbsp of tea leaves is generally how much I use).

  • Sweetener: 1 cup of organic cane sugar (the fuel for the acid production).

  • The Powerhouse: 1 cup of 100% pure, unsweetened pomegranate juice.

  • The Culture: 1 healthy pellicle + 1-2 cups of starter liquid (mature kombucha).

2. The Process

  1. Brew the Base: Steep the tea in two to three cups of boiling water for 10 minutes. Stir in the sugar until dissolved.

  2. The Cooling Phase: Let the tea reach room temperature. Crucial: Never add the SCOBY or pomegranate juice to hot tea, as heat can damage the live cultures and the delicate antioxidants in the juice.

  3. The Blend: In your glass fermentation jar, combine the cooled tea, the pomegranate juice, and the starter liquid.

  4. Introduce the SCOBY: Gently place the pellicle on top. Cover the jar with a breathable cloth secured by a rubber band.

  5. Ferment: Place the jar in a warm, dark spot 21-27 C or (70–80°F). Let it ferment for 7 to 10 days.

3. Why This Works

By the end of F1, the "harsh" sugars in the pomegranate juice have been converted. What remains is a tart, deep-red tonic rich in Glucuronic acid and Urolithin A (a compound produced by gut bacteria from pomegranate that helps with cellular aging).

Why First Fermentation (F1) is Superior

In a standard kombucha, the SCOBY (Symbiotic Culture Of Bacteria and Yeast) converts sugar into ethanol and then into organic acids. Adding pomegranate juice during the primary phase provides a more complex "fuel" for the bacteria.

Microbial Synergy: When pomegranate juice is added in F1, the bacteria have more time to metabolize the specific polyphenols (like punicalagins) found in the fruit. This can actually stimulate the production of Glucuronic acid more effectively than adding it at the end.

Bioavailability: The fermentation process "pre-digests" the pomegranate nutrients. This breaks down complex tannins into smaller, more bioavailable antioxidants that your body can absorb more easily.

pH Stability: Pomegranate is naturally acidic. Adding it early helps lower the starting pH, which creates a safer environment for the beneficial bacteria to thrive and produce those health-promoting metabolites.
